Hi there!

❌ As noted in our README, js.org is focusing on granting subdomain requests to projects with a clear relation to the JavaScript ecosystem and community.

Projects such as personal pages, blogs, and Discord bot pages will no longer be accepted. Projects such as NPM packages, libraries, tools that have a clear direct relation to JavaScript, will be accepted when requesting a JS.ORG subdomain.
